Introduction to Mulch Types: Plastic vs Organic

Plastic mulch, made from polyethylene film, creates a barrier that effectively blocks sunlight, inhibiting weed germination and growth by depriving seeds of light and moisture. Organic mulch, consisting of materials like straw, wood chips, or compost, suppresses weeds by blocking light and promoting beneficial soil microorganisms that outcompete weeds over time. Both mulch types offer weed control benefits, but plastic mulch provides immediate and more consistent weed suppression, while organic mulch enhances soil fertility and structure.

How Plastic Mulch Suppresses Weeds

Plastic mulch effectively suppresses weeds by creating a physical barrier that blocks sunlight, preventing weed seed germination and growth beneath the soil surface. Its impermeable properties reduce oxygen availability to weed seeds, further inhibiting their development. By maintaining consistent soil moisture and temperature, plastic mulch also creates an unfavorable environment for weed establishment compared to organic mulches.

Weed Control Effectiveness of Organic Mulch

Organic mulch provides effective weed control by creating a physical barrier that suppresses weed seed germination and growth. Materials such as wood chips, straw, and shredded leaves decompose over time, enriching soil health and enhancing microbial activity, which further inhibits weed development. While less impermeable than plastic mulch, organic mulch improves long-term weed management through natural soil conditioning and moisture retention.

Installation and Maintenance Differences

Plastic mulch requires precise installation with soil beds prepared and edges secured using landscape staples or soil mounding to prevent lifting, while organic mulch like straw or wood chips can be spread directly over soil without heavy equipment. Maintenance of plastic mulch involves monitoring for tears and removing or replacing sections annually, whereas organic mulch decomposes gradually, needing periodic replenishment and potential weed removal within the mulch layer. Plastic mulch provides a more consistent weed barrier with minimal gaps, but organic mulch improves soil health and moisture retention while requiring more frequent upkeep.

Impact on Crop Growth and Yield

Plastic mulch enhances crop growth and yield by increasing soil temperature, conserving moisture, and providing effective weed suppression, which reduces competition for nutrients and light. Organic mulch improves soil structure and fertility through decomposition, but it may harbor weeds initially and can temporarily immobilize nitrogen, potentially limiting early crop development. Selecting plastic mulch generally results in higher yields due to its superior weed control and microclimate modification, while organic mulch benefits long-term soil health with moderate impact on immediate crop productivity.
